Catatan
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ba masuk atau mengubah direktori.
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ba mengubah direktori.
fungsi
Berlaku untuk:
pemeriksaan Databricks SQL
Databricks Runtime 17.1 ke atas
Important
Fitur ini ada di Pratinjau Publik.
Nota
Fitur ini tidak tersedia di gudang Databricks SQL Classic. Untuk mempelajari selengkapnya tentang gudang Databricks SQL, lihat Jenis gudang SQL.
Mengembalikan true jika dua nilai input GEOMETRY bersinggungan.
Syntax
st_intersects ( geoExpr1, geoExpr2 )
Arguments
-
geoExpr1: NilaiGEOMETRY. -
geoExpr2: NilaiGEOMETRY.
Returns
Nilai jenis BOOLEAN, menunjukkan apakah kedua nilai input saling bersinggungan GEOMETRY .
Untuk detail selengkapnya dan definisi formal, lihat predikat Intersects dalam definisi matriks DE-9IM.
Fungsi mengembalikan NULL jika salah satu input adalah NULL.
Kondisi kesalahan
- Jika geometri input tidak memiliki nilai SRID yang sama, fungsi mengembalikan ST_DIFFERENT_SRID_VALUES.
Examples
-- Returns true if geometries intersect.
> SELECT st_intersects(st_geomfromtext('POINT(1 1)'),st_geomfromtext('POLYGON((0 0,10 0,0 10,0 0))'));
true
-- Returns false if geometries do not intersect.
> SELECT st_intersects(st_geomfromtext('POINT(5 6)'),st_geomfromtext('POLYGON((0 0,10 0,0 10,0 0))'));
false